Kansas State forward Coleman Hawkins was named to the Karl Malone Power Forward of the Year Watch List, the school announced Thursday.
Hawkins, a fifth-year senior who transferred this past offseason from Illinois, had a tremendous season for the Illini in 2023-24. The Sacramento, California native was the third-highest scorer on the team (12.1 PPG) to go along with a team-best 6.1 RPG. Hawkins’ defensive prowess was crucial to the Illini’s success last season, as the team advanced to the Elite Eight before being eliminated by the eventual-champion UConn Huskies.
Hawkins’ performance earned him All-Big Ten Second Team honors last season. This is the second-straight season that Hawkins appears on the Karl Malone Watch List.
The Wildcats begin their season on Nov. 5 against New Orleans. Fans may begin voting for the Karl Malone Power Forward of the Year Award on Nov. 1.
